FSI simulation
 
Problem Statement

I am simulating the sphere in a pipe. It moves under the aerodynamic/hydrodynamic forces. It is moving plus sphere is also changing shape under the influence of applied forces by fluid.

Problem

I have seen in ansys help the I cannot simulate the case where the system coupling boundary (sphere in my case) is also deforming i.e. changing its shape. As it is quoted in system coupling guide that :

Quote:

The mesh on the fluid-structural interface is static, so as the fluid mesh is modified to accommodate
the deformation in the transient system, the mapping on this coupling interface stays consistent.


What is the proposed solution to this problem? Any idea?

I read somewhere that mesh morpher is good in this case!!!
